Many doctrines and denominations teach today that sin is OK in the life of the believer. But what does the Bible say about sin? As believers are we saved 'in sin' as many modern doctrines claim or are we truly saved 'from sin'?
Any doctrine that makes allowances for sin is a doctrine of compromise. In 2 Thessalonians 2 Paul speaks of the great apostasy where Paul predicts that many believers will be lead astray by doctrines that allow sin. Paul makes reference to this apostasy again in 2 Timothy 3: 1 - 5:
"But mark this: There will be terrible times in the last days. People will be lovers of themselves, lovers of money, boastful, proud, abusive, disobedient to their parents, ungrateful, unholy, without love, unforgiving, slanderous, without self-control, brutal, not lovers of the good, treacherous, rash, conceited, lovers of pleasure rather than lovers of God— having a form of godliness but denying its power. Have nothing to do with such people"
If you notice, all of the attributes listed are the complete of opposite of the evidences (fruits) of the indwelling Holy Spirit, which is the manifestation of God's divine grace and nature in our lives. If we learn to rely on the indwelling Christ instead of the flesh, then intentional - premeditated sin should be nonexistant in our lives. We know this because of the many scriptures gives which tell us that believers shouldn't sin. Here are a few examples:
